Where to Watch White House Plumbers Season 1 Episode 1

Here’s where to watch White House Plumbers Season 1 Episode 1, the premiere of the much-anticipated political drama miniseries starring Woody Harrelson and Justin Theroux on the Watergate scandal.

The first episode of White House Plumbers is directed by David Mandel, who is also serving as executive producer for the series. The episode is titled ‘The Beverly Hills Burglary,’ and new episodes will be released on a weekly basis until the five-episode miniseries finale on May 29. Veep alums Alex Gregory, and Peter Huyck created and executive produced White House Plumbers.

Where can I watch and stream White House Plumbers Season 1 Episode 1?

Fans can watch House Plumbers Season 1 Episode 1 on HBO Max and HBO starting Monday, May 1.

The White House Plumbers cast features Lena Headey, Judy Greer, Domhnall Gleeson, Toby Huss, Ike Barinholtz, Kathleen Turner, Kim Coates, Yul Vazquez, Alexis Valdés, Nelson Ascencio, Tony Plana, Zoe Levin, Liam James, Kiernan Shipka, Tre Ryder, David Krumholtz, F. Murray Abraham, as well as Rich Sommer, and John Carroll Lynch.

“White House Plumbers takes the audience behind-the-scenes of the Watergate scandal as Nixon’s political saboteurs, E. Howard Hunt (Woody Harrelson) and G. Gordon Liddy (Justin Theroux) accidentally toppled the presidency they were zealously trying to protect… and their families along with it. Chronicling actions on the ground, this satirical drama begins in 1971 when the White House hires Hunt and Liddy, former CIA and FBI, respectively, to investigate the Pentagon Papers leak. After failing upward, the unlikely pair lands on the Committee to Re-Elect the President, plotting several unbelievable covert ops – including bugging the Democratic National Committee offices at the Watergate complex. Proving that history can sometimes be stranger than fiction, White House Plumbers sheds light on the lesser-known series of events that led to one of America’s greatest political crimes.”

The list of executive producers includes Harrelson, Theroux, Mandel, Ruben Fleischer, Gregg Fienberg, David Bernad from The District, and Frank Rich, along with Paul Lee, Nne Ebong, and Mark Roybal from wiip and Len Amato from Crash&Salvage.
